Also, it’s worth noting that even if you only have 100ml in a larger bottle, it’s the size of the container that counts, and it still won’t be allowed through. The TSA’s travel size rule says you can bring a 1 quart -sized bag of liquids, aerosols, gels, creams, and pastes in your carry-on bag and through the checkpoint. You can only bring water through security if it’s less than 100ml. In general, TSA rules for checked luggage are much more lenient than for carry-ons, so you can pack everything from drinks and other liquids well over 3.4 ounces to certain types of weapons.
